Phan Hoang Diep, a former cross-country runner from Lam Dong, was once a barefoot boy from the Di Linh Plateau. Today, he continues his journey in sports, no longer as a professional athlete but as someone inspiring a love of running among boys and girls in the red-soil highlands.

From Champion to Inspiring the Next Generation

"I used to be part of the Lam Dong athletics team. My journey began as a barefoot child sprinting along the red-dirt paths in Gia Hiep. Over time, running took me across the country — from stadium tracks to cross-country paths over hills and passes. Running has truly become an integral part of my identity,” Phan Hoang Diep reminisced.

Growing up in Gia Hiep, Phan Hoang Diep started as an amateur runner for his local commune and later for Di Linh District. During the 2003 Lam Dong Provincial Cross-Country Championships, he competed while also taking on coaching responsibilities and achieved remarkable results. This led to his selection for the Lam Dong provincial cross-country team.

“Phan Hoang Diep was an athlete with remarkable innate ability. He largely taught himself and trained independently, yet his accomplishments were quite impressive. After being part of the provincial team for just over a year, Diep clinched the national 7-km championship in 2005,” stated Ho Van Chuong, a cross-country coach at the Lam Dong Center for Sports Training and Competition.

Chuong noted that the rise of Diep and other barefoot runners from Di Linh brought a refreshing change to the running scene in Lam Dong at that time.

Cultivating a Passion for Running

After ending his competitive sports career in 2010, Phan Hoang Diep returned to assist with his family's farming, focusing on coffee cultivation and durian tree care. Nonetheless, his love for running continued to thrive.

He established a cross-country running club with numerous members, consisting of both adults and students from the Di Linh region, who engage in regular training sessions every week.

“Children in Gia Hiep, Tam Bo, and Bao Thuan have few recreational opportunities. Running together not only enhances their fitness but also brings them joy. I introduce them to cross-country running and aim to foster a passion for every stride they take on their own land,” stated Phan Hoang Diep.

“Phan Hoang Diep is a distinguished running coach in the region and has significantly contributed to the promotion of running not only in Gia Hiep Commune but also across the Di Linh area. Notably, he has been instrumental in advancing the well-known Brah Yang Mountain Cross-Country Race, inspiring hundreds of young people to take up the sport,” stated Pham Xuan Truong, Secretary of the Gia Hiep Commune Youth Union.

“He offers free training sessions to his young athletes, including children from ethnic minority communities. For races held away from their hometown, he actively seeks out sponsors to assist with their costs. Youth Union officials in Bao Thuan and Gia Hiep communes collaborate closely with Diep to enhance cross-country training and competitions.”

The barefoot boy from the Di Linh Plateau has grown into a dedicated mentor who continues to pass his love of running on to the next generation. He has contributed to the development of running events across Lam Dong, helping create the appeal of races that take athletes across mountain passes and rugged terrain.

In 2024, Phan Hoang Diep was honored to be nominated for the Outstanding Grassroots Coach category at the Vietnam Running Awards — a valuable recognition of his nearly three decades of dedication to generations of young barefoot runners.
